When it comes to a congresswoman cursing versus a congressman embracing white supremacy, cable news apparently believes the cursing deserves more coverage – five times more coverage, to be exact.
The discrepancy was the most glaring on Fox News, which devoted 52 minutes of coverage to Democratic Rep. Rashida Tlaib’s cursing and just 42 seconds to Republican Rep. Steve King’s comments about white supremacy. That’s over 74 times more coverage of Tlaib.
